Sunstone Hotel Investors Inc Announces 2024 Dividend Tax Treatment

Understanding the Tax Implications for Common and Preferred Stockholders

Author's Avatar
Jan 30, 2025

Sunstone Hotel Investors Inc (SHO, Financial), a lodging real estate investment trust, has announced the tax treatment for its 2024 distributions to holders of its common stock and Series H and Series I preferred stock. The announcement, made on January 30, 2025, details the record and payable dates, as well as the taxable amounts for the distributions. Stockholders are advised to consult with personal tax advisors to understand the specific tax implications of these distributions.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is the total distribution per share for common stock in 2024?

A: The total distribution per share for common stock in 2024 is $0.090000.

Q: How is the common stock dividend taxable?

A: Approximately 33.33% of the common stock dividend is taxable in 2024, and 66.67% is taxable in 2025.

Q: What are the record and payable dates for the Series H preferred stock?

A: The record dates are March 28, June 28, September 30, and December 31, 2024, with payable dates on April 15, July 15, October 15, 2024, and January 15, 2025.

Q: Who should stockholders consult regarding the tax treatment of distributions?

A: Stockholders are encouraged to consult with a personal tax advisor regarding their specific tax treatment.
